## Configuration

The `strex` script walks the `src/` tree, pulls every `t(...)` call, and dumps keys into `locales/pending.json`. Reviewers: it's idempotent, so rerunning is safe. Output paths and ignore globs live in `strex.config.js`. The only env-level setting is the upload credential for pushing strings to our Glimmerloft translation service — add it on the next line.

sealed setting: VAULT_KEY20=69e2a0b23f1a79fbf692

Archiving a cold storage bucket in Frostvault is a one-call job: POST to the archive endpoint with the bucket name and a retention tier, and the mover daemon handles the rest overnight. Heads up — archived buckets are read-only until restored. For local testing against the staging mover, use the key just below.

service key, kawif-yahig: zpat11_2yR07ZhXO2n

**Mgmt Meeting Minutes — Retiring the Brightline Range**

Quick recap for sales leads at Fenholt Supplies: we agreed to retire the Brightline fixture range by year-end. Remaining stock moves to clearance pricing next month, and accounts on standing orders get migrated to the Lumetta range. Trade-in incentives were approved in principle. The confidential note on next steps sits just below.

board note of bajof-bajeg: The pricing group signed off on a budget of $13.4 million for Project Sildor. The renewal with Lamixek Holdings closes at $48.9 million a year, 49 percent above the last contract.